[英]clang-format: always break EACH PARAMETER if don't fit
// Try this first, ref 1:
SomeCall(aaa, bbb, ccc);
// If doesn't fit do this, ref 2:
SomeCall(aaa,
bbb,
ccc);
// Don't do, ref 3:
SomeCall(
aaa, bbb, ccc);
我發現目前在每個參數(參考 2)之后自動中斷的唯一方法是參考 3 上的選項不適合。 即使 ref 3 適合,我也想成為 ref 2。 我使用 clang 11。
AlignAfterOpenBracket: Align
PenaltyBreakBeforeFirstCallParameter: 9999
基本上將 Penalty 值設置得非常高
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.